It looks like you need to compile the modules and install them.
I had this problem with RAID, forgot to install the modules after
I told the kernel via .config to load RAID1 as a modules. You are
trying to load lvm.o from your 2.2.5-15 modules.

> I compiled the 2.2.12 kernel with the lvm as a module using the
> patch-2.2.11-LVM.gz patch with no problem.
> When I boot I find though it can not load the lvm module because of the
> following unresolved dependencies:
>
> Oct 1 11:42:32 persephone insmod: /lib/modules/2.2.5-15/block/lvm.o:
> unresolved
> symbol del_mddev_mapping
> Oct 1 11:42:32 persephone insmod: /lib/modules/2.2.5-15/block/lvm.o:
> unresolved
> symbol md_hd_struct
> Oct 1 11:42:32 persephone insmod: /lib/modules/2.2.5-15/block/lvm.o:
> unresolved
> symbol add_mddev_mapping
>
>
> Has anyone seen this? Am I forgetting some other option?
